Simple really - I'm leaving work, so I want to remove all my emails from my private POP3 account.

How do I export my OE inbox, email it to myself at home (I can do that bit ) and then merge it in to my outlook at home?

First compact the folders.

Then do a search in File manager for the .dbx files the address book is .wab - Copy them all to CD.

Contacts. Save as a CSV file on CD.

Just remember when you are putting them onto the new machine make sure the folder isnt read only.

You can use a tool like DBXtract to do this. It'll save off each OE e-mail to an EML file, which can be opened/imported into Outlook nicely. You'll end up with a chuffing great set of folders full of the files, but you can zip these up & mail them /burn 'em to CD.
